Sanitation vs. Sanitization
What's the Difference?
Sanitation and sanitization are both important practices for maintaining cleanliness and preventing the spread of germs and diseases. Sanitation refers to the overall cleanliness and hygiene of an environment, including proper waste disposal, clean water supply, and personal hygiene practices. Sanitization, on the other hand, specifically refers to the process of cleaning and disinfecting surfaces and objects to kill germs and bacteria. While sanitation focuses on preventing the spread of disease through overall cleanliness, sanitization targets specific areas or objects to eliminate harmful pathogens. Both practices are essential for promoting health and well-being in both public and private spaces.

Further Detail
Definition
Sanitation and sanitization are two terms that are often used interchangeably, but they actually have distinct meanings. Sanitation refers to the overall cleanliness and maintenance of a space or environment to prevent the spread of disease and promote health. This can include practices such as waste disposal, water treatment, and personal hygiene. On the other hand, sanitization specifically refers to the process of reducing the number of microorganisms to a safe level, typically through the use of chemicals or heat.
Goal
The goal of sanitation is to create a clean and healthy environment that is free from contaminants and disease-causing agents. This can involve a combination of practices such as cleaning, disinfecting, and waste management. Sanitation measures are typically implemented on a larger scale, such as in public spaces, communities, and healthcare facilities. On the other hand, the goal of sanitization is to specifically target and eliminate harmful microorganisms that can cause illness. This process is often used in food preparation, medical settings, and water treatment.
Methods
Sanitation practices can include a wide range of methods, such as cleaning with soap and water, using disinfectants, and proper waste disposal. These methods are aimed at preventing the spread of germs and maintaining a clean environment. Sanitation measures can also involve education and awareness campaigns to promote good hygiene practices. In contrast, sanitization methods focus on killing or reducing the number of microorganisms on surfaces or in substances. This can be achieved through the use of chemicals like bleach or alcohol, as well as heat treatments such as steam or boiling.
Applications
Sanitation is important in a variety of settings, including homes, schools, restaurants, and hospitals. By maintaining a clean environment and practicing good hygiene, the spread of infectious diseases can be prevented. Sanitation measures are also crucial in disaster relief efforts and in developing countries where access to clean water and proper waste disposal is limited. On the other hand, sanitization is commonly used in food processing and preparation to ensure that products are safe for consumption. It is also essential in healthcare settings to prevent the spread of infections among patients and healthcare workers.
Regulations
Both sanitation and sanitization are subject to regulations and guidelines set forth by government agencies and health organizations. These regulations are in place to ensure that proper practices are followed to protect public health and safety. For example, the Food and Drug Administration (FDA) in the United States sets standards for food sanitation and sanitization to prevent foodborne illnesses. Similarly, the World Health Organization (WHO) provides guidelines for sanitation practices in healthcare settings to reduce the risk of healthcare-associated infections.
